Signs You Need Exhaust Service

Early detection of exhaust issues is vital for maintaining a quiet, fuel-efficient, and safe vehicle. Our ASE-certified technicians recommend staying alert for changes in your car's sound or smell that could indicate a deteriorating system. Addressing these minor red flags immediately at our exhaust repair shop prevents more costly damage to your engine or catalytic converter.

Ignoring these symptoms can lead to significant engine strain and decreased fuel efficiency over time. If your vehicle feels sluggish or sounds uncharacteristically loud, our team provides precise evaluations to identify these behavioral red flags:

  • Loud Noises: Identifying deep growls or sharp ticking sounds that signal a failing muffler or a leaking exhaust manifold.
  • Foul Odors: Detecting toxic fumes inside the cabin to prevent dangerous carbon monoxide exposure for you and your family.
  • Visible Damage: Spotting rusted pipes, broken hangers, or dragging components that could lead to a sudden roadside breakdown.
  • Reduced Efficiency: Monitoring unexpected drops in fuel economy caused by improper backpressure from a clogged or leaking exhaust.
  • Vibration Issues: Feeling unusual shaking or rattling under the floorboards that indicates loose hardware or internal muffler failure.

Muffler Repair & Replacement

Our ASE-certified technicians understand that a failing muffler is more than just a noise nuisance; it impacts your engine’s backpressure and overall efficiency. Over time, moisture and road salt lead to corrosion, specifically at the seams. We provide precise evaluations to determine if your vehicle requires a simple hardware fix or a complete component replacement.

When internal baffles loosen or the exterior housing rusts through, your vehicle’s sound dampening and emissions control are compromised. We utilize manufacturer-quality equipment to inspect the entire assembly, ensuring your car remains quiet and safe. 

Our professional team offers specialized solutions to restore your vehicle’s exhaust integrity:

  • Muffler Replacement: Installing premium, sound-absorbing mufflers to restore quiet operation and maintain proper engine backpressure for peak performance.
  • Hanger Repair: Replacing worn or broken rubber hangers to prevent the exhaust from dragging or vibrating against the chassis.
  • Clamp Securing: Tightening or replacing rusted clamps to seal leaks and ensure a stable connection between exhaust pipe sections.
  • Baffle Assessment: Diagnosing internal rattling sounds to determine if the muffler’s sound-dampening structure has structurally failed or collapsed.
  • Corrosion Treatment: Evaluating surface rust versus structural rot to recommend the most cost-effective and reliable long-term repair path.

Frequently Asked Questions


Is It Safe To Drive With An Exhaust Leak?

Driving with a suspected exhaust leak is not recommended because fumes can sometimes enter the cabin and affect your health. Small leaks can also grow, which may increase noise or damage other components. We suggest having the system inspected as soon as you can to understand your specific situation.
